Question 2

How many milliliters of full-strength Sustacal are needed to prepare 300 mL of a 3/4-strength Sustacal solution?
 
  1. 225 mL
  2. 450 mL
  3. 900 mL
  4. 950 mL

The average person is easily confused by the terms pharmaceutics and pharmacology, thinking they are one and the same. Whereas pharmaceutics is the science of preparing and dispensing drugs (otherwise known as the science of pharmacy), pharmacology is the study of medications.

Nearly all drugs pass into human breast milk. How often a drug is taken influences the amount of drug that will pass into the milk. Medications taken 30 to 60 minutes before breastfeeding are likely to be at peak blood levels when the baby is nursing.
